The reason why the argument in favour of individual Reincarnation in the case of human beings, advanced on p. 64 of The Growth of the Soul, does not apply to the case of animal life, will be found on p. 446 of the same book. The soul- consciousness gradually evolving through the animal kingdom is shared at each stage of the process by a considerable number of animals. " Each animal it (the common soul of that division of the animal kingdom) ensouls draws equally on the common stock o...f knowledge and experience ; one consciousness shares EXTRACTS FROM THE vAHAN 6l the fresh experience of each. When one animal of a given family, for example, suffers, the common soul suffers. Just as, in the case of a human being, if the right hand is injured the man suffers, though his left hand or foot may not be suffering. " We are still far from understanding the whole subject thoroughly. Why it should be necessary that any suffering should be endured by consciousness at the early animal stage of its evolution, is one of many mysteries concerning the design of the cosmos, which we must be content to reserve for considera- tion until we are at least on the intellectual level of the Adepts.
